1) THREAD: The 2019 Joint Report on Multilateral Development Banks’ (MDBs) Climate Finance was released yesterday. I look at how this finance has changed over time and what is being targeted post-2020 by the MDBs👇 @ADB_HQ @WorldBank @EBRD @AfDB_Group @EIB @AIIB_Official @the_IDB
2) All the MDBs have seen an increase 📈 in their climate finance as a % of their total operations 👏

3) But the MDBs recognise that climate finance needs to be higher still and they have all set some form of post-2020 climate finance target 👇
4) Some MDBs include fossil fuel finance as climate finance - when looking at OECD project level data. The MDBs use a joint methodology for tracking climate finance, this allows some fossil fuel switching & efficiency improvements
5) Now, let’s look at the post-2020 climate finance targets across the MDBs🔍. Some have set a percentage of total operations target and some have set an absolute ($) climate finance target. This makes comparison tricky – see bank by bank below.
6) The @EIB and @AIIB_Official have the highest climate finance % target - set at 50% of total operations by 2025. The @EBRD has the equivalent target for green finance. Whilst the @WorldBank target of $200Bn between 2021-2025 represents a large increase.
7) The climate finance target at the @AfDB_Group is $25Bn between 2021-2025 ($5Bn annually), a large increase compared to 2019.
8) Next, the @ADB_HQ has a climate finance target of $80Bn between 2019-2030 or around $7.2Bn annually.
9) The @AIIB_Official has an ambitious climate finance target of 50% of total operations by 2025.
10) The @EBRD reports green finance & climate finance. The green finance target is 40% of total operations by 2020 and 50% of total operations by 2025.
11) The @EIB also has an ambitious climate finance target of 50% of total operations by 2025.
12) The @the_IDB has a climate finance target of 30% of total operations by 2020. This target turns into a finance floor between 2020-2023
13) The @WorldBank has a climate finance target of $200Bn between 2021-2025, ($40Bn annually). This includes private capital mobilised by the World Bank Group.
